Blanck Mass, one half of noise duo Fuck Buttons, creates beautiful, damaged soundscapes on new LP
Blanck Mass creates a kind of deep, hauntingly beautiful soundscapes that seep into your subconscious. He recently released the new LP World Eater, and it patches together damaged sound collages that somehow come out the other side as beautiful diamonds of electronic pop. Especially on “Please,” a somber track crafted on a yearning vocal sample that builds to a resounding crescendo, the music has a quality that seems otherworldly. Below you can listen to “Please,” which has already cemented a place in my top 10 of the year, along with the more brittle and bombastic “Silent Treatment.” Grab the whole LP if you like what you hear.
